Diagnosis

The diagnosis of a doctor for ADHD depends on several factors. The most important element is whether the patient exhibits symptoms that correspond to the clinical diagnosis of ADHD in adulthood, as defined by the American Psychiatric Association in its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ders Fifth Edition (DSM-5).

There isn't a single test that can be used to diagnose ADHD. Instead doctors will evaluate the patient's symptoms and how they affect his or her daily life.

The first step in the diagnosis process is to speak with the patient as well as his or her family members and acquaintances about the symptoms. This helps the doctor understand the ADHD symptoms and the impact they have on the patient as well as those around him. It also provides the opportunity to investigate the possibility of co-occurring disorders, like depression, anxiety or substance abuse.

Another essential part of the examination is a physical examination. The doctor will be looking for signs of other illnesses that can affect an individual's performance, such as sleep apnea or thyroid disease or vitamin deficiency.

It is essential that patients feel comfortable sharing their concerns with their physician during an evaluation. adhd testing for adults online can cause anxiety and stress for both the patient and their loved ones.

An experienced doctor will employ checklists and rating scales to evaluate the symptoms of a patient. During the exam, the provider will inquire about the patient's behavior in various contexts, including school, work and social situations.

In some cases the physician may ask the patient to complete an examination that tests attention or responsiveness. These tests employ an instrument that can be used to show pictures or sounds that a patient must respond quickly and accurately. The clinician reviews the patient's responses and compares them to those of others who have similar attention-related responses.

According to the American Psychiatric Association, doctors should diagnose ADHD in patients who exhibit five or more signs of Inattentiveness Hyperactivity Impulsivity. It is important to remember that symptoms can change in time.

Medication: [Redirect-301] The most popular treatment for ADHD is stimulant drugs. They are used to stimulate the brain to release dopamine, which is a chemical that aids in focusing. These medications are available in a variety of forms, such as capsules and tablets. They can help you concentrate and manage your impulsive behaviors, but they also can cause some adverse negative effects. For instance, those who suffer from heart disease or high blood pressure should not take these medications.

Nonstimulant medication: Some people suffering from ADHD are treated with atomoxetine. This boosts the brain chemical norepinephrine. While it can improve the ability to focus and reduce impulsiveness, it can also cause liver damage and suicidal thinking.

Cognitive behavioral therapy: Counseling can help change negative thought patterns that cause poor decisions or behavior. It can help you with issues at work, school and in relationships which could be the result of adhd symptoms test.

Family counseling and therapy for marital issues Counseling options like these can aid you and your family deal with the stress that ADHD can create. They can aid you and your spouse communicate more effectively and increase the ability to solve problems.

Other therapies: Neurofeedback is a specialized kind of therapy that utilizes technology to help you learn to regulate your brain waves. It can assist with a variety of disorders, including depression and anxiety.
